kill-doc:重新定义文档下载体验的技术利器

发布时间:2026/5/19 16:05:36

kill-doc:重新定义文档下载体验的技术利器 kill-doc重新定义文档下载体验的技术利器【免费下载链接】kill-doc看到经常有小伙伴们需要下载一些免费文档但是相关网站浏览体验不好各种广告各种登录验证需要很多步骤才能下载文档该脚本就是为了解决您的烦恼而诞生尽可能做到自动化项目地址: https://gitcode.com/gh_mirrors/ki/kill-doc你是否曾在深夜为了一份急需的学术资料而反复点击广告弹窗是否因为某个文档平台的强制登录而放弃重要的参考资料又或者面对那些只能在线预览却无法保存的文档感到束手无策kill-doc 正是为解决这些痛点而生的开源工具让你能够直接下载浏览器中可见的任何文档内容。与传统手动下载方式相比使用 kill-doc 可以将文档获取时间从平均 10 分钟缩短到 1 分钟以内效率提升超过 90%。它通过智能绕过广告与登录验证直接定位文档资源让文档下载回归简单本质。五分钟快速上手立即体验文档下载革命环境准备与安装要开始使用 kill-doc你需要准备以下环境安装浏览器扩展首先在 Chrome、Firefox 或 Edge 浏览器中安装 Tampermonkey 扩展获取脚本访问脚本仓库页面点击安装此脚本启用脚本在 Tampermonkey 管理面板中确认脚本已启用注意部分浏览器需要在扩展管理页面启用开发者模式才能安装用户脚本。立即验证安装效果安装完成后访问任意支持的文档平台如百度文库、道客巴巴等你将在页面右上角看到 kill-doc 的功能面板。如果面板没有出现请按 F5 刷新页面并检查 Tampermonkey 扩展是否正常运行。快速测试访问一个文档页面点击自动预览按钮观察页面是否开始自动滚动。这是确认脚本正常工作的最简单方法。架构解析文档下载背后的智能机制工作原理像快递分拣系统一样处理文档kill-doc 的工作流程可以类比为智能快递分拣系统内容识别系统扫描页面识别文档类型和资源位置障碍突破智能绕过广告、登录验证等访问限制内容提取根据文档类型选择最优提取策略文件生成将内容转换为指定格式并触发下载// 简化的核心工作流程 function processDocument() { detectDocumentType(); // 识别文档类型 bypassRestrictions(); // 绕过访问限制 extractContent(); // 提取文档内容 generateFile(); // 生成下载文件 }核心设计决策为什么选择 Canvas 提取许多文档平台采用 Canvas 渲染技术防止内容复制传统的 DOM 解析方法只能获取空容器元素。kill-doc 通过 Canvas 像素分析技术能够精确还原文档内容这是其核心技术优势之一。技术权衡虽然 Canvas 提取比 DOM 解析更复杂但它能有效应对现代文档平台的防复制措施确保下载成功率。场景化应用指南三大典型使用场景场景一学术论文批量下载背景研究生需要从多个学术平台下载 20 篇相关论文进行研究。操作步骤在 kill-doc 配置中启用批量模式将目标论文 URL 列表保存到script/urls.txt文件中执行批量下载命令系统自动处理所有链接下载完成后文档按预设命名规则组织在指定文件夹预期效果原本需要数小时的手动操作现在只需 10 分钟即可完成全部下载。场景二在线文档格式转换背景企业员工需要将网页版技术文档转换为可编辑的 Word 格式。操作步骤访问目标文档页面点击 kill-doc 功能面板中的格式转换选项选择目标格式支持 PDF、Word、TXT 等系统自动转换并下载文件注意事项转换质量取决于原始文档的渲染质量建议在转换前确保页面完全加载。图1kill-doc 批量链接生成功能界面支持快速获取多个文件的共享链接场景三网盘文件批量处理背景团队需要从网盘分享页面获取多个文件链接进行协作。操作步骤访问网盘分享页面点击批量链接按钮加载文件列表使用一键拷贝下载链接功能导出所有地址将链接分发给团队成员或用于其他自动化流程技术要点kill-doc 能够处理常见的网盘防爬机制确保链接有效性。进阶配置个性化你的下载体验模块化配置系统kill-doc 提供了灵活的配置选项你可以根据需求调整以下参数// 常用配置参数示例 const config { downloadPath: ~/Documents/research, // 下载文件保存路径 fileFormat: pdf, // 输出格式pdf/html/txt autoRename: true, // 自动重命名文件 bypassAds: true, // 广告绕过功能开关 delayTime: 3000, // 操作延迟时间毫秒 batchMode: false // 批量模式开关 };功能对比表功能特性基础模式高级模式专家模式自动预览✅✅✅批量下载❌✅✅格式转换基本格式多种格式全格式支持自定义脚本❌❌✅性能优化标准优化极致优化扩展开发指南如果你需要为特定网站开发自定义下载逻辑可以在autox/目录下创建新的脚本文件// 自定义模块基础结构 (function() { use strict; // 特定网站的下载逻辑 function customDownloadLogic() { // 实现针对该网站的特殊处理 } // 注册到主程序 if (window.killDoc) { window.killDoc.registerModule(custom-site, customDownloadLogic); } })();图2kill-doc 文件分享功能细分界面支持批量链接、一键分享和单个文件分享最佳实践与避坑指南常见问题解决方案脚本安装后无反应检查 Tampermonkey 扩展是否启用确认当前网站是否在支持列表中按 F5 刷新页面重新加载脚本下载内容出现乱码尝试在配置中调整编码设置utf-8 或 gbk检查原始文档的编码格式使用下载图片功能替代文本提取大文件下载失败分页下载先下载前 100 页刷新页面后继续下载剩余部分调整预览速率避免请求过于频繁使用下载图片功能后续手动合并性能优化建议网络环境优化在稳定的网络环境下使用避免下载中断内存管理处理大型文档时关闭不必要的浏览器标签页速率调整根据网站响应速度调整预览速率参数缓存利用重复访问同一文档时利用浏览器缓存提高效率安全使用注意事项重要提醒kill-doc 仅用于下载你拥有合法访问权限的文档。请遵守版权法规尊重内容创作者的劳动成果。仅下载个人学习研究所需的文档不用于商业用途或大规模内容爬取控制下载频率避免对目标服务器造成过大压力在使用公共网络时特别注意下载内容的合法性图3kill-doc 链接精细化操作界面支持批量复制链接和直接下载生态整合与未来发展与其他工具的集成kill-doc 可以与以下工具无缝集成OCR 工具下载的图片文档可通过 OCR 工具转换为可编辑文本文档管理系统自动将下载的文档分类存储到指定系统自动化工作流通过脚本调用 kill-doc 功能实现文档处理自动化社区资源与支持问题反馈遇到问题时请提供详细的文档地址和错误信息功能建议欢迎在项目页面提出新功能需求贡献指南如果你有开发能力可以参与项目代码改进未来发展方向kill-doc 团队正在规划以下功能增强AI 增强识别利用人工智能技术提高文档类型识别准确率云端同步实现多设备间的配置和下载记录同步插件生态系统建立第三方插件市场扩展支持更多文档平台移动端支持开发移动端版本支持手机浏览器使用立即开始你的高效文档下载之旅通过本文的介绍你已经全面了解了 kill-doc 的功能特性、使用方法和最佳实践。无论你是学术研究者、企业员工还是普通学习者这个工具都能显著提升你的文档获取效率。下一步行动建议立即安装 Tampermonkey 扩展和 kill-doc 脚本选择一个你经常使用的文档平台进行测试根据实际需求调整配置参数将使用经验分享给有同样需求的朋友记住技术的价值在于解决实际问题。kill-doc 正是这样一个专注于解决文档下载痛点的实用工具。开始使用它让文档获取不再成为你学习和工作的障碍。最后提醒合理使用技术工具尊重知识产权让技术真正服务于学习和研究的需要。【免费下载链接】kill-doc看到经常有小伙伴们需要下载一些免费文档但是相关网站浏览体验不好各种广告各种登录验证需要很多步骤才能下载文档该脚本就是为了解决您的烦恼而诞生尽可能做到自动化项目地址: https://gitcode.com/gh_mirrors/ki/kill-doc创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关新闻